Ingredients
Scale
- 2 sheets puff pastry (thawed)
- 6 tablespoons Nutella (adjust to taste)
- 1 tablespoon milk (for brushing)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Unroll the puff pastry on a lightly floured surface and cut into triangles.
- Place about 1/2 tablespoon of Nutella at the wide end of each triangle and spread slightly.
- Roll each triangle from the wide end to the point, sealing the edges tightly.
- Brush the tops with milk for a glossy finish.
- Bake on a parchment-lined baking sheet for 15-20 minutes until golden brown.
- Serve warm and enjoy!
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
